    On 25 July 2011, New Zealand was gripped by its coldest winter snap in fifteen years. [5] The lowest temperature set during the month was −10.2 °C (13.6 °F) at Manapouri (in the southwest corner of the South Island) on 26 July, which was a new all-time record for the town. Christchurch Airport recorded its second-coldest day on 25 July.

    The lowest temperature on record in New Zealand (−25.6 °C or −14.1 °F) was recorded at Ranfurly in 1903. [3] Heavy frosts are common throughout winter. The town is sheltered from the prevailing rain patterns by the mountains to the west.

    Summers can be hot, with temperatures often approaching or exceeding 30 degrees Celsius; winters, by contrast, are often bitterly cold – the township of Ranfurly in Central Otago holds the New Zealand record for lowest temperature with a reading of −25.6 °C on 18 July 1903.
